From: Victor Julien Date: Mon, 16 Sep 2013 16:29:53 +0000 (+0200) Subject: Coverity 1038095: remove dead code from defrag hash timeout code X-Git-Tag: suricata-2.0beta2~360 X-Git-Url: http://git.ipfire.org/gitweb.cgi?a=commitdiff_plain;h=aecefd00bd253927a5197e8a7d813c12b3ee11e2;p=thirdparty%2Fsuricata.git Coverity 1038095: remove dead code from defrag hash timeout code --- diff --git a/src/defrag-timeout.c b/src/defrag-timeout.c index 57fda56763..991a00c1c3 100644 --- a/src/defrag-timeout.c +++ b/src/defrag-timeout.c @@ -128,8 +128,7 @@ uint32_t DefragTimeoutHash(struct timeval *ts) { for (idx = 0; idx < defrag_config.hash_size; idx++) { DefragTrackerHashRow *hb = &defragtracker_hash[idx]; - if (hb == NULL) - continue; + if (DRLOCK_TRYLOCK(hb) != 0) continue;